Quarterly Planning Note — Gross-Margin Review

Hi branch managers — quick heads-up before the Q2 cycle kicks off. Head office ran a gross-margin review across all Tallowbrook branches, and the short version is: the Merrin line is carrying us, while the Delf accessories range is dragging margins down nearly three points. Expect revised pricing sheets by month-end and a push to trim slow-moving stock. Please hold off on new promo commitments until then. The confidential note on next year's plans sits just below.

internal memo for hahif-hahaf: Headcount on the Zorwyn team goes from 9 to 100 by the end of October. Gross margin on Zorwyn came in at 5 percent against a plan of 10 percent.

## Build Provenance — Quotaforge Tenant Limits

Support staff: each Quotaforge release that changes per-tenant rate quota defaults carries a signed provenance record. When a customer disputes a throttling decision, confirm which build enforced the limit before escalating, since quota tables are baked in at build time. The relevant build token for the current release is listed just below.

session token of tagef-hahag = htk4_f22a

## Marrowpipe Queue — Log Compaction Store

Compaction on the Marrowpipe message queue runs every four hours and collapses superseded records per key, keeping only the latest offset. Compaction state — watermarks, segment manifests, and retry counters — is persisted in a small bookkeeping database rather than on the brokers themselves. On-call: if compaction stalls, check the watermark table before restarting anything. The compactor reaches that bookkeeping database using the connection string below.

warehouse DSN: mssql://rusdor_svc:0FSWCn9@db-951a.paliqforge.local:5432/ulawyn

## Escalation — SproutCycle Scheduler

If watering jobs stall past two missed cycles, page the on-call via the Greenline rotation. Do not restart the queue manually; state drift will duplicate pump commands. Check the drift monitor first. If the backlog exceeds 500 jobs or valve hardware faults appear, escalate to the Hydra platform lead immediately. Release manager signs off before any hotfix ships outside the Tuesday window. Document every escalation in the SproutCycle incident log. For urgent escalation, reach the platform lead here.

pager mailbox: fenael_wenael@norvalabs.corp